  • Compact design creates cafe-quality coffee right at home
  • ThermoJet heating system: achieves the optimum extraction temperature in 3 seconds with instantaneous transition from espresso to steam
  • Auto purge: ensures your next espresso is extracted at the right temperature
  • Precise espresso extraction: Digital Temperature Control (PID) delivers water at the right temperature +/- 2°C, ensuring optimal espresso extraction
  • Automatic microfoam milk texturing: adjust the milk temperature and texture to suit your taste and create latte art

Quote from BruceInCola :
Why? What's the difference?
H24 fits between 14 and 20 grams of ground coffee
H28 fits between 18 and 23 grams

He means, that it is a bad idea to fit, say, 16 grams of coffee into the latter basket. Because there will be too much empty space on top. Many people like "18g ground coffee in, 36ml espresso out"; then the H24 is better for them.

This is a machine I recommend to most beginner espresso enthusiasts. I had this machine several years ago, and its quite good in my opinion. I eventually upgraded to the Breville Dual Boiler due to a variety of reasons, but still recommend the Bambino and Bambino Plus to most.

Going through the comments in this thread, the inconsistency issue is because the cheaper machines use thermoblock technology that heats the water "on the fly". The advantage of this technology is super fast start-up times (ready to brew in ~3 seconds after starting the machine). The disadvantage is that your first shot will be inconsistent, so I advice people to "purge" the brewer for few seconds with hot water to get to stable temperature. Just 2-3 second blank shot is adequate. Then put the portafilter and brew your espresso.

The automatic frother is really great, and I really appreciated that in my early days before I learnt to texture milk manually. For folks who like Latte/Cappucino or other milk based drinks, its a godsend.
